Phoebe stormed out of the psychiatrist's office an hour later. Mind you, she was feeling a little better. All that yelling at lessened the stress a bit. Andrew had come no closer to figuring out why Phoebe was filing for a divorce, and Phoebe had come no closer to finding out if Cole had gone back to his old ways. Cole came storming out after Phoebe.

"Are you crazy?" Cole asked her. "You came this close to blowing whatever chance you have at a normal life!"

"No Cole, I didn't. I knew he wouldn't believe me anyway if I told him the truth." Phoebe said. "And besides, my life is never going to be anywhere near normal."

"You shouldn't risk your life! Normal or not. You would be shoved into some sort experimental facility if anyone ever found out what you are." Cole said. Phoebe never said anything for a second.

"My life Cole? Or this hell otherwise known as my life? Everything I ever do brings me pain." Phoebe shouted at him.

"Your life, whether or not it includes me, will get better. And you will carry on saving innocents for the rest of that life." Cole said quietly.

"I never doubted that Cole. I know being a witch isn't a curse. I know life will get better, once I get over you." Phoebe said, before walking away. Cole didn't bother going after her. He had heard what he needed to, Phoebe still wasn't over him. He smiled in spite of everything, and walked away.

"A witch." The man grinned as he stepped out of the shadows as soon as Cole had disappeared. "How interesting."



"Paige!" Phoebe shouted as she entered the manor. There was no answer. "Piper?" She shouted. "Anyone?" She shouted again. She walked into the kitchen where she found0 a note from her sisters telling her that they had received a call from Darryl, saying there was another murder. They had left to meet him at the crime scene. Taking note of where the had gone, Phoebe grabbed her keys and left the manor.

"Hey, what's going on?" Phoebe asked when she reached the scene.

"Twenty four years old. Scorch marks on chest." Piper explained.

"Oh no.." Phoebe said.

"What is it?" Paige asked.

"This is the same place that I saw in my premonition. With Cole.." She explained. Piper froze everything.

"The body's over there." Piper said. "See if it's the same guy."

Phoebe made her way to the body while Piper and Paige stayed behind. Seconds later she returned, allowing Piper to unfreeze everyone.

"It wasn't him." Phoebe said. "What now?" She asked. Just then Darryl walked up to them.

"Seems they all belong to some sort of cult called 'The Quadrant'. That's all we have so far." Darryl said.

"We'll look in the Book of Shadows." Paige offered.



"So how'd the counselling go?" Paige asked once they were back home.

"Let's not talk about that right now." Phoebe said as she leafed through the book. "Here. 'The Quadrant.' Apparently they're humans that live to destroy good." Phoebe said.

"Great. Another enemy." Piper said. "But what kind of demon would kill an ally?"

"Seems the Quadrant aren't high on the list of praise. They aren't on friendly terms with demons either." Phoebe explained.

"What match are ordinary humans to demons AND everything good?" Paige asked confused.

"Well, they're not exactly ordinary humans. They use chants as well as supernatural weapons to get what they want." Phoebe said.



The man walked into a seemingly empty warehouse. 'I have located a witch!" He shouted. As if in reply another man appeared from within another room, followed by ten others.

"A witch?" Another man asked.

"A strong one. I could feel her power from metres away." The first man said.

"Very well. You find her, and use whatever means you must to bring her here. But do not harm her. We will use her to ward off the Cyprus, then eradicate her." The second man said. The first nodded in apprehension before exiting the warehouse.



"Leo!" Piper yelled for the fourth time. "Where are you!" She stopped as the saw the familiar blue light form in front of her, before Leo appeared. "Honey, where were you? She asked before leaning forward to kiss her husband hello.

"I have, well, training." Leo said.

"Whitelighter training?" Paige asked.

"Only happens every fifty years or so. Just to keep us in check." Leo explained. "I'm not going to be able to come down her for the next two days or so."

"What? What if something happens?" Phoebe asked.

"Someone will come. Just not me." Leo explained.

"Great." Piper said. "My husband is going AWOL on me." Leo pulled Piper into him.

"Not for long." He said. "So why was I so urgently needed?"

"The Quadrant. What do you know about them?" Paige asked.

"I'm not sure. I would ask, but.." He started.

"Yeah, yeah. Training and all." Piper said smiling. "My reliable whitelighter. It's not that urgent. We'll figure it out." They were interrupted by a knock on the door.

"I'll get it." Phoebe said. She opened the door and gasped as she recognised the man from her premonition that Cole had thrown an energy ball at. She was even more surprised when the man grabbed her and injected something into her that made things, slowly, go black.
